June 11, 2021 - Good news after it was established yesterday that Slovenian tourists would not need to go into self-isolation when returning from the Adriatic counties, according to the decision of the Slovenian Government to remove the Croatian coast from its red list, which will take effect from tomorrow. At yesterday's session, the Slovenian Government decided that the Adriatic Croatia administrative unit is no longer on their red list.
